Small Patio and Garden Ideas: Maximize Your Outdoor Space

Transforming a small outdoor area into a lush, functional garden is less about square footage and more about smart design. A compact patio or balcony garden can become a personal sanctuary, a place to unwind with a morning coffee or host intimate gatherings under the stars. The key lies in maximizing every available inch while ensuring the space feels open, uncluttered, and alive with color and texture.

The foundation of any successful small patio plan is its layout. Instead of pushing all furniture to the edges, consider creating distinct zones for dining, lounging, and gardening. A free-standing bar cart or a narrow console table can define a seating area without overwhelming the space. Keeping the primary walkway at least 30 inches wide ensures the area feels accessible and prevents the room from looking like a cluttered storage zone.

When ground space is at a premium, the vertical plane becomes your most valuable asset. Installing a vertical garden on a blank wall or fence immediately draws the eye upward, creating a stunning visual feature that also acts as a natural privacy screen. Mounting troughs, wall-mounted pockets, or a classic trellis allows you to grow everything from fragrant herbs to trailing petunias without sacrificing a single square foot of floor space.

  • Wall-mounted pockets or fabric planters are lightweight and easy to maintain.
  • Trellises covered in climbing beans or jasmine provide both shade and scent.
  • Stackable planters or tiered stands maximize corner spaces effectively.

Furniture and Furnishings that Work Hard

Choosing the right furniture is non-negotiable for a small garden. Opt for multi-functional pieces that serve dual purposes, such as a storage ottoman that doubles as a coffee table or a fold-away bistro set that can be tucked away when not in use. Materials like powder-coated aluminum or teak offer durability and a slim profile, ensuring the furniture feels substantial without blocking light or views.

Lighting extends the usability of your patio well beyond sunset, transforming the atmosphere from daytime utility to nighttime magic. Skip the harsh overhead fixtures and instead layer your lighting. Use warm, low-voltage path lights to guide the way, string fairy lights through greenery for a whimsical glow, and place a statement lantern on the table to create a focal point. This layered approach enhances safety while adding depth and character to the space.

Color choice can dramatically alter the perceived size of a small patio. A palette of soft neutrals, such as whites, creams, and gentle grays, reflects light and creates a sense of openness. Introducing color through throw pillows, planters, and a single statement piece of furniture adds vibrancy without overwhelming the senses. Mirrors are another clever trick; a well-placed outdoor mirror opposite a window or green backdrop visually doubles the room and amplifies natural light.

Plants are the soul of the garden, but in small spaces, selection is critical. Focus on a few high-impact specimens rather than a jungle of tiny pots. A tall, architectural palm or a sculptural fiddle-leaf fig can act as a living sculpture, while hanging baskets filled with cascading greenery draw the eye upward. For fragrance and utility, dedicated planters for rosemary, lavender, or mint thrive on a sunny railing and put fresh ingredients literally at your fingertips.

Maintaining Your Oasis

Sustainability is key to ensuring your small garden remains a joy rather than a chore. Invest in quality soil and a drip irrigation system to ensure consistent hydration with minimal effort. Group plants with similar water and sun requirements together to streamline care, and choose durable, low-maintenance materials for furniture and decking. With a little foresight, your compact patio can flourish season after season, offering a timeless escape right outside your door.
